Output 17832c922d64fd2142ac431e94a31bf7486443481d075bcd1f79016475a02fe8:3

value
79000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e8d97cdb29351b2bb2b64425a9e63a579ff0faa OP_EQUALVERIFY OP_CHECKSIG
address
16hkWwtcu8RqQMYL7woQGpvn7BH9LMDTCr
transaction
17832c922d64fd2142ac431e94a31bf7486443481d075bcd1f79016475a02fe8
confirmations
594360
spent
true